Ingredients of South African-style Buttermilk Rusk Biscuits:
- Need 2 1/2 cup - Cake flour
- Make ready 2 tbsp of Buttermilk powder
- Require 1 tsp - Baking powder
- Provide 100 ml Sugar (granulated)
- Get 75 grams of Melted butter
- Require 1 - Egg (Medium)
- You need 100 ml for Water
- Require 200 ml for Nuts, etc. (optional)
South African-style Buttermilk Rusk Biscuits instructions:
- Preheat the oven to 180℃.
- Add the sugar to the melted butter and combine with a whisk until creamy. Break in the egg and stir it in.
- Combine the flour, buttermilk powder, and baking powder, and sift. Add half of the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ients and stir with a fork.
- Add the rest of the dry ingredients and the water. Stir.
- Optionally stir in the nuts, oats, etc.
- Grease a baking pan and pour in the mixture. Bake for 50 minutes at 180℃.
- Here is what it looks like when done.
- Use 2 forks to divide into 16 portions. They taste better when they have a jagged cross-section.
- Remove from the baking pan. (The photo shows the bottom side.)
- Baking them again will evaporate the moisture. Place the cross-section sides facing up into a heat-resistant or baking tray.
- Bake for 1 hour at 100℃. Flip over and bake for another hour.
- They're done. Since I have a tiny oven, I stacked the pieces and baked them.
